Artificial Intelligence is revolutionizing how we approach the security of cyber-physical systems. These systems, which integrate computing, networking, and physical processes, are foundational in sectors like energy, transportation, and healthcare. As of today, April 20, 2026, AI's role in enhancing CPS security has become indispensable, presenting both remarkable opportunities and unforeseen challenges.
Let's begin by examining AI-driven cyber ranges, a fascinating development in this space. A study published in June 2025 introduced a novel AI-based cyber range architecture. This system merges cloud-based simulations with emulation components to create a hybrid environment for testing and improving CPS security. The results are striking: this system achieved a 91.3% accuracy rate in detecting coordinated cyber attacks, illustrating AI's ability to effectively identify threats that could otherwise slip through conventional defenses. Moreover, it reduced the detection-to-mitigation time by 34% compared to traditional methods. To put this in perspective, if the previous systems required 30 minutes to respond to a security breach, the new AI-enhanced system can do it in about 20 minutes. This reduction is not just a matter of efficiency; in security terms, it can mean the difference between a controlled incident and a full-blown crisis.
The power sector, crucial for its role in almost every facet of modern life, is another area where AI has made significant strides. In September 2024, research demonstrated the use of artificial neural networks, such as feedforward and long short-term memory networks, in monitoring cybersecurity for DC/DC power converters. These converters are vital components in power electronics, ensuring the smooth operation and distribution of electricity. By utilizing AI, researchers were able to identify and calculate false data inputs, significantly bolstering the resilience of these converters within CPS. This advancement not only improves operational efficiency but also protects against potential malicious attacks aimed at disrupting power supply, a critical aspect of national security.
Moving beyond terrestrial applications, AI is also enhancing the security of satellite-based IoT networks. A December 2024 study presented a hybrid AI framework leveraging high-performance computing architectures to fortify these networks. Satellite communications are essential for global connectivity, supporting everything from GPS to international broadcasting. The AI framework developed in this study improved detection accuracy and reduced false positives, underscoring AI's critical role in safeguarding these satellite communications. Given the increasing reliance on satellite-based IoT networks for applications like environmental monitoring and global internet services, enhancing their security is paramount.
Now, when discussing hardening cyber-physical systems against attacks, AI plays a multifaceted role. A comprehensive book published in 2023 delved into various methods of using AI to reinforce CPS security. This resource covers techniques for strengthening software, hardware, firmware, infrastructure, and communication channels against diverse attack vectors. It serves as a vital reference for engineers and designers striving to build secure and dependable CPS. By integrating AI into these systems, designers can preemptively identify vulnerabilities and enhance the robustness of their platforms, thus ensuring that critical infrastructure remains secure against evolving threats.
Furthermore, a book released in 2026 offers a holistic perspective on how AI technologies can bolster CPS security. This work covers AI-enabled threat detection, anomaly detection in flexible manufacturing systems, machine learning for CPS resilience, and secure communication frameworks, supplemented by practical case studies. These insights are invaluable, providing a broad spectrum of strategies that can be adapted to specific industry needs. For instance, in manufacturing, effectively detecting anomalies can prevent production disruptions and ensure product quality, while in communication networks, robust frameworks can maintain data integrity and privacy.
However, with these advancements come new challenges. While AI significantly enhances CPS security, it simultaneously introduces potential vulnerabilities. The complexity of AI components can inadvertently create opportunities for cyberattacks if they are not properly managed. In August 2023, an article on Forbes highlighted this dual-edge nature of AI in cyber-physical environments. It stresses the necessity for robust security and privacy frameworks specifically tailored for AI systems to prevent potential breaches. This is a critical consideration, as the sophistication of AI can sometimes outpace the security measures designed to protect it, leading to inadvertent weaknesses in otherwise secure systems.
Moreover, the integration of AI into CPS isn't just about developing new technologies but also involves scaling them effectively across different sectors and regions. This scaling requires significant investment in infrastructure and training, as well as collaboration between governments, private sector partners, and educational institutions. The need for skilled professionals who can design, implement, and manage AI-enhanced security systems is growing, highlighting a broader trend in the technology industry towards AI literacy and education.
